Here's one way to do it:
1. (L v M) & (L v ~S)
2. A -> ~L
3. A -> (~M v S) :. ~A
-------------------------
4. L v (M & ~S) 1 Distribution
5. ~~L v (M & ~S) 4 Double Negation
6. ~L -> (M & ~S) 5 Material Implication
7. A -> (M & ~S) 2,6 Hypothetical Syllogism
8. A -> (~M v ~~S) 3 Double Negation
9. A -> ~(M & ~S) 8 De Morgan's Law
10. ~~(M & ~S) -> ~A 9 Transposition
11. (M & ~S) -> ~A 10 Double Negation
12. A -> ~A 7,11 Hypothetical Syllogism
13. ~A v ~A 12 Material Implication
14. ~A 13 Tautology
